Find the strain and stress on a 1.5 inch diameter cylinder which is subjected to a load of 7.8 tons and measures 11.92 inches instead of the original 12 inch length. What is the Modulus of Elasticity for the material?

7.8 tons is 15,600 lb.
Divide than by the area in square inches (pi*0.75^2) for the stress in p.s.i.
The modulus of elasticity is (stress)/(strain)
The strain, which is dimensionless, is 0.08/12 = 6.67*10^-3
